Quinta da Prelada was a farm located in the Portuguese city of Oporto, consisting of a mansion, gardens and fountains of Portuguese Baroque style of the eighteenth century.

The main building was built in 1754 based on plans by the Italian architect Nicolau Nasoni. It was built by the families of Noronha and Menezes. His work remained unfinished. The building was designed along three floors connected by stairs with four towers, of which only one was built. Doors, balconies and windows are made of granite, decorated in baroque style

The garden features a maze (the largest in the Iberian Peninsula), obelisks, statues and a lake with a small castle.

One of the main highlights is the main entrance where the plaque lies, richly decorated with a quite detailed and large family crest and two columns at the sides featuring two sirens of stone.

In 1904 it became property of the Catholic Church as a gift.
